Electrical Problem?
I just got my headers put on and when i got my car back the air bag sign wont go off and my stering wheel buttons for my radio dont work at all. It looks like a fuse but i checked the fuses and nothing. If anyone knows what else it could be please let me know thanks.
#2
let me guess.they removed the steering shaft to install the headers?but they didn't tie the steering wheel off so it couldn't turn to far and break the clock spring in the steering columb.i believe its going to be finger pointing time very shortly.
